People who need support shouldn’t be discouraged says Kangana Ranaut

Published on

Actress Kangana Ranaut has reacted on Rani Mukherji’s statement on #MeToo movement by saying that people who need support shouldn’t be discouraged in the society.

Kangana Ranaut was interacting with media at the Mumbai airport on Wednesday in Mumbai.

Recently, at a news channel’s actresses’ round table conference, actress Rani Mukerji made a statement about Me Too and got trolled heavily on social media.

Rani Mukerji shared her views on #MeToo and said, “I think as a woman you have to be that powerful within yourself, you have to believe that you’re so powerful that if you ever come into a situation like that you have the courage to say ‘back off.’ I think you have to have the courage to be able to protect yourself,” adding, “you have to take responsibility for your own self.”

After Rani’s opinion, Kangana Ranaut was also asked about what she thought of Rani’s stance on #MeToo , to which the actress said, “People who need support, who need to be empowered, we must empower but agar Rani Laxmi Bai jaise ladkiyan agar humari society humein de sakti hai toh why not, unko discourage nahi karna chahiye. If they are strong women, we should not discourage women. I was 16-years-old when I filed my first FIR against sexual assault so there are people who can stand up for themselves, they shouldn’t be discouraged.”

Kangana was asked about children who are not empowered and she said, “Empowerment who need, they should be empowered but not necessarily everyone needs. Some people can give empowerment also. Some people are givers, the ones who can should be encouraged to give strength, people who are working with NGOs.”

Kangana Ranaut next will be seen playing titular role in ‘Manikarnika – The Queen of Jhansi’.

It also stars Atul Kulkarni, Ankita Lokhande, Mishti, Jisshu Sengupta, Suresh Oberoi, Danny Denzongpa and Kulbhushan Kharbanda in pivotal roles.

It is directed by Radha Krishna Jagarlamudi and Kangana Ranaut. The film is produced by Zee Studios in association with Kamal Jain and Nishant Pitti.

The film is scheduled to be released on 25 January 2019.
